FEATURES OF THE FORMATION OF A RECRUITMENT QUEUE AMONG STATE PEASANTS USING THE EXAMPLE OF VITEBSK PROVINCE (1831–1861)

Abstract
This article explores the specifics of recruitment among state peasants in the Vitebsk Governorate of the Russian Empire from 1831 to 1861. The main difference between state peasants' recruitment obligations and those of landowners' peasants was the rather strict regulation of recruitment queue formation by Russian law. Key factors influencing the formation of the recruitment queue included the number of workers in the family, law-abidingness, and financial situation. This system was not perfect. It was characterized by numerous violations by peasants and officials. Overall, the recruitment queue formation procedure for state peasants was similar to that of Christian bourgeois. This system ensured a relatively high level of state control compared to that of landowner peasants.
